Abbey Boutique Hotel Adults Only - Warwick
-28.22526, 152.0271Located within 10 minutes' walk of Rose City Shopping World, Abbey Boutique Hotel Adults Only Warwick includes 13 rooms with views of the garden. Complimentary private parking is available on site as well.
Location
This hotel is conveniently situated within 25 minutes' walk of Leslie Park. The 4-star hotel in Warwick is within 25 minutes' walk of Warwick Art Gallery. The accommodation also gives access to sports attractions like Morgan Park Raceway, which is 3.6 km away.
A local bus stop Locke St at Abbey Of The Roses hail 'n' ride is only a 10-minute walk away.
Rooms
Some of the renovated rooms feature a cable flat-screen television as well as a minibar, coffee and tea making facilities. They are furnished with canopy beds or queen size beds along with a wardrobe and a work desk. Providing complimentary toiletries and dressing gowns, the private bathrooms are also equipped with a rain shower and a foot bath.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served in the restaurant each morning.
A full breakfast is served at the price of AUD 30 per person per day.
Leisure & Business
Leisure facilities in the Abbey Boutique Hotel Adults Only include a tennis court, a veranda, and a shared lounge. The Abbey Boutique Hotel Adults Only Warwick offers cycling, tennis, and chess and many other activities.
